Market Pulse: Balanced ⚖️
The Lynch Station, VA real estate market is currently a Balanced Market. Homes are retaining 101% of their value (Sale Price to List Price Ratio). With 8 active listings and 6 closed sales this month, inventory remains at 4.8 months of supply. Trends over the last half-year show median values moving down by 8%, while Average Days on Market has decreased by 16%. Listings in Lynch Station are moving 7 days faster than the Campbell average.

How is the real estate market in Lynch Station, VA performing right now?
The data indicates a stable environment in Lynch Station, VA. Inventory is at 4.8 months, meaning a balanced environment with steady turnover. Inventory levels provide a healthy range of options for prospective buyers.
What are the current pricing trends for Lynch Station, VA real estate?
Currently, $385,000 represents the median entry point in Lynch Station, VA. Over the past half-year, home values in Lynch Station have moved downward by approximately 7% based on regional transaction data.
Are sellers in Lynch Station, VA getting their full asking price?
Sellers hold significant leverage in Lynch Station, VA, with a Sale Price to List Price Ratio of 101.3%. On average, properties in Lynch Station are transitioning from active to sold status in 56 days.
